Records in Lookup not visible until user selects them once from Tab

Records are not visible in a lookup until the user goes to the tab for the underlying object and clicks on the record for the first time.  It doesn't matter if another user entered the record, or if the record was imported using the APEX data loader.  Any help on why this is so?  It does not appear to be a security issue as it happens even with "modify all data" set on the user profile.
By default a lookup shows recently used objects.  If you haven't used any objects recently then the lookup will initially be blank until you search on something.
Thank you.  I see now that if I just search on any character, the list gets populated.  Thanks again.